I guess you wonder where I’ve been — in my best Bobby Caldwell voice. But all jokes aside, I realized today that it’s been over a month since I last posted on Medium. While this might not mean much to some, it’s notable for me because next month, June, marks the anniversary of my start on Medium four years ago, and I have been very consistent in my writing on the platform.

In fact, last year, I generated a steady stream of secondary income by publishing here a few times a month. But lately, the energy has shifted, and I’ve felt frustrated by all the changes to the platform. But more than that, I’ve had to confront the fact that many reasons I fell in love with Medium have quietly disappeared.

At the top of that list is the slow erasure of publications centered on Black culture.

I don’t think I have ever shared this, but I began posting on Medium because of my love for ZORA magazine. ZORA is a medium publication dedicated to sharing stories from the perspectives and experiences of Black women.
